On Wed, 2005-02-16 at 13:09 -0700, Eric "Shubes" wrote: > Jim wrote: > > The last time I looked into it, under linux NTFS could only be mounted > > read only. I had heard it was possible to mount an NTFS partition > > read/write but this could cause damage to the filesystem. > > > > Is this still the case, or was that just something someone told me? > > > > Jim > > > That is still the case as far as I can tell. > See http://sourceforge.net/projects/linux-ntfs/ ---- it's probably a good idea to have a fat32 partition for data to be passed back & forth between dual-boot operations and not rely on Linux writing to ntfs partitions.
